Using Steam Achievement Manager can lead to a ban. Steam's terms of service prohibit the use of third-party tools to manipulate achievements. Even if it seems harmless, it breaks the rules, which can result in suspensions or permanent bans. It’s best to play games as intended to avoid any issues with your Steam account.
